F630 Negative travel limit exceeded
A command was executed which resulted in an axis position outside the
negative travel range. The axis has been brought to a standstill with the
error response "Set velocity command value to zero."
Cause:
Parameter A103, Negative travel limit exceeded.
Remedy:
1. Verify Parameter A103, Negative travel limit.
2. Check program.
Procedure:
Clear error
If the power supply was turned off, turn it back on.
Move the axis into the permissible working range.
Note: Only those command values which lead back into the allowed
working range will be accepted. With other command values,
the drive will stop again.
Parameter A111, Switching threshold is used to implement
a hysteresis function.
F634 Emergency-Stop
Actuating the emergency stop (E-Stop) switch has caused the drive to
stop by setting the velocity setpoint value to zero.
Cause:
The emergency stop switch was detected.
Remedy:
Eliminate the malfunction that has caused the emergency switch to be
activated, and clear the error.
F643 Positive travel limit switch detected
The positive travel limit switch has been activated. The axis has been
brought to a standstill with the error response "Set velocity command
value to zero."
Cause:
The positive travel limit switch has been detected.
Remedy:
1. Reset the error.
2. Turn the power supply back on.
3. Move the axis into the permissible travel range.
Note: Command values which would move the axis outside the
permissible range are not accepted, and this error message is
generated again.
